AUTHOR'S / SPONSOR'S STATEMENT OF INTENT

 

At intersections that include state highways, the Texas Department of Transportation (TxDOT) oversees the operations of any traffic signal signs or lights.  TxDOT follows the rules established by the Texas Manual on Uniform Traffic Control Devices for traffic light intervals.  The use of this standard by TxDOT provides the driving public with standard intervals at all traffic light locations which control intersections with state roads.  However, this standard is currently not applied to an intersection at which a photographic traffic monitoring system is in use.  

 

H.B. 614 requires that all intersections which monitor traffic with red light cameras follow the rules established by the Texas Manual on Uniform Traffic Control Devices so that motorists have uniform expectations for the yellow light intervals.

SECTION BY SECTION ANALYSIS

 

SECTION 1.  Amends Chapter 544, Transportation Code, by adding Section 544.013, as follows:

 

Sec. 544.013.  STANDARD INTERVAL REQUIRED FOR CERTAIN TRAFFIC-CONTROL SIGNALS.  (a)  Defines "photographic traffic monitoring system" and "recorded image."

 

(b)  Requires the minimum change interval for a steady yellow signal at an intersection at which a photographic traffic monitoring system is in use to be established in accordance with the Texas Manual on Uniform Traffic Control Devices.

 

SECTION 2.  Effective date: September 1, 2007.
